Clayton County Register, 07 Dec. 1938.
Wm. John Schmidt died at his home in Wagner township on Nov. 30 at 8:00 p.m. following an illness of two and one-half weeks caused by a fall.
Mr. Schmidt was born Sept. 21, 1864 in Garnavillo, the son of John and Caroline (Gumtow) Schmidt. January 06, 1888, at Clayton Center, he was united in marriage with Sophia Kamin. She preceded him in death in 1923, as did also one son, John, in 1914.
Surviving are one son, Arthur of St. Olaf and two daughters, Mrs. Herman Schlake of Farmersburg and Mrs. Geo. Lemke of St. Olaf besides five grandchildren and one great-grandchild.
Mr. Schmidt received his education in the public schools after which he took up farming which was his life-work.
Funeral services were held Saturday, December 03 in the Zion's Lutheran church at Clayton Center with the Rev. O. M. Meyer officiating. Casketbearers were: Fred Orvis, K. K. Stearns, Henry Wilke, Henry Larson, Harry Barnum and Clarence Peterson.
